Paint Arena: The first ever Windows Mixed Reality app that lets people of all ages paint in 3D or play paintball in a shared social experience with voice chat, on both HoloLens and Immersive headsets from all over the world. NEW: AI Robot "Pablo" will walk you through the basics. Teleport around, explore the arena, have a conversation, or do a silly dance together. Once you are ready, join into the arena for a casual game. Simply guess what someone else is drawing or draw something for others to guess. Feeling energy for action? Try our multiplayer MR Paintball, splatter your friends or the arena with lovely colors. Remember to dodge and refill! Follow us on Twitter at https://twitter.com/Paint_Arena and share videos or screenshots of your best 3D paintings or MR paintball games with hashtag #Paint_Arena :) Conceptualization: Many virtual reality games today are designed to enhance graphic intensity and immersion, but increasingly isolate the players. We believe Windows Mixed Reality can be much more than that. We decided to design a casual game that people of all ages can play, share, and socialize in mixed reality. We were inspired by a classic interactive puzzle game for friends and family, while we were amazed by the potential of the mixed reality motion controllers, so Paint Arena was born. Instructions: You will need a HoloLens or a WMR immersive headset with a mixed reality motion controllers (and headphones, if not Samsung Odyssey) to enjoy this experience. This social experience is best enjoyed in a casual standing pose. If you feel you are not at the right height after app launch, simply stand up, look forward, and say or tap "Reset Floor Level". You could draw and talk to others and guess each others' drawings. If you are the first one to join, you would be assigned the drawer for the first round. You would be given a random word. Draw something to help others guess the word (without drawing any letters or digits). Once someone guesses your word correctly, a guesser will chosen at random to become the drawer. Toggle "Painting On" to "Paint Balling" to start shooting paintballs and splatter the arena. Each full tank contains 100 paintballs. Every 5 seconds, you can partially refill the tank with 20 paintballs by pressing "Refill 20 Paintballs" button or saying the voice command "Refill Paint Ball". Try to move around to dodge incoming paintballs, or teleport to reposition. Score by reducing others' health bars to zero, upon which they would enter ghost mode and respawn at a random location in 10 seconds. In Immersive headsets: Make sure you set up boundary for all experiences before you begin. While "Painting On", once you see your robotic right hand holding a paint brush, you can press the right hand trigger button to start drawing. While "Paint Balling", you can aim with your right hand controller, and press right hand trigger to shoot paintballs. Once you see your robotic left arm holding a motion controller, you can use the touch pad to select paint color. Alternatively, you can tap "Pick Color" to bring up the large color wheel. If you made a mistake, you can say "Erase Last Stroke" or press right hand controller grab button. You can also clear all strokes by saying "Erase All Strokes". To rotate your view, point the joysticks left or right on one of the motion controllers. To teleport, make sure the panel shows "Teleport On". Then point your cursor at the floor with one of the motion controllers, and hold the joystick forward until a Teleport marker appears, then release the joystick. In HoloLens, you can use gaze, tap gesture to select options on the menu in front of you (look below chest level). You can use the same voice commands as elaborated above. While "Painting On", you can reach your hand out in front of you, pinch and hold while dragging the paint brush along. While "Paint Balling", you can aim with your gaze and air tap to shoot paintballs. Before teleporting in HoloLens, make sure the panel shows "Teleport On". Then you can use your gaze to aim, and then tap to dash across the map! You could also hide the Guessing Window and the Panel if they are blocking your gazes. Remember to turn off teleport before drawing or shooting.
